Road construction season is not over yet. MnDOT annouced Tuesday that beginning Sept. 11, Highway 52 motorists will be detoured between Fountain and Preston for approximately two weeks.

The 7-mile stretch between Fountain and through Preston is under construction to repair the concrete along the stretch of highway. Local traffic remains for people who live along the route or for people to reach businesses on the route.

The detour route from the north at Fountain is Fillmore Co. Rd 8, east toward Lanesboro to Hwy 16 south of Lanesboro back to Hwy 52. The detour from the south is in reverse. Hwy 16 motorist approaching Hwy 52 from the west will not be able to join with Hwy 52 in Preston, they'll need to detour north to Hwy 80 to the detour route at Fountain. Vehicles going to POET Biorefining in Preston may use Hwy 16 for accessing the plant.

Motorists will be alerted to the work in advance, as the work requires the removal of some concrete panels in the road where the joints have failed or panels are in need of replacement. Work is expected to be completed by Sept 26th, with weather permitting.
